HSQL automaticky generované názvy

publikováno: 12.5.2013

Právě mě potrápila databáze HSQL když mi vyhazovala chybu "integrity constraint violation: unique constraint or index violation" s názvem omezení, které začínalo na SYS_. Aniž bych si pořádně přečetl název omezení, začal jsem zbytečně hledat chybu jinde. Poté co jsem si podle názvu omezení rozklíčoval o co se vlastně jedná to byla hračka. Proto sem dávám seznam všech prefixů automaticky generovaných názvů databázových objektů v HSQLDB, aby v tom bylo jednou pro vždy jasno:

  • SYS_IDX_ = index (for auto-indexes on referring FK columns or unique constraints)
  • SYS_PK_ = primární klíč (for the primary key constraints)
  • SYS_REF_ = cizí klíč (for FK constraints in referenced tables)
  • SYS_FK_ = cizí klíč (for FK constraints in referencing tables)
  • SYS_CT_ = unique nebo check (for unique and check constraints)

Reference

Podavane informace byly aktualni, byly vysvetlene i souvislosti, hlavne na uvod byl dobre vysvetlen kontext probiraneho tematu, teda co je co a jaky to ma vyznam. Navic bylo cele skoleni podporeno

Petr

S priebehom kurzu som bol nadmieru spokojný. Na kurze ma zaujali okrem klasickej teorie aj prakticke príklady ktoré boli podané s plnohodnotným vysvetlením. Myslím že v rámci školenia bol venovaný

František

Vazim si otvorenost lektora, ktory bol ochotny podelit sa o svoje dlhorocne znalosti a skusenosti v obore, pristup k studentom bol neformalny, co nakoniec vytvorilo vybornu atmosferu na pokladanie dotazou

Lukáš


Novinky

24.6.2018: Změny v licencování Oracle JDK
Od Java 11 (včetně) Oracle JDK bude zdarma pro vývoj a testování, ale ne pro produkční použití.

10.6.2018: Srovnání rychlosti mapovacích frameworků
Porovnání MapStruct, Dozer, Orika, ... z pohledu rychlosti

10.6.2018: JetBrains: State of Developer Ecosystem 2018
Statistika nuda NENÍ :-)